Description
This 6 year old home is set on a large area of land on the East Coast with stunningly beautiful views of the sea and Te Oneroa beach. The expansive deck is perfect for those late morning breakfasts or early evening BBQs. If you are looking for somewhere to get away from the hussle and bustle of city life or you are a keen fisherman, then this is the place for you.
This holiday home is perfect for small, medium or large families. There's lots of flat surrounding land for boats, to pitch tents and for kids to play cricket, volleyball, badminton and frisbee. There is also a tractor (available by enquiry) to launch your boat at nearby Maraetai Bay and fixed kennels for hunters who have dogs.
Enjoy the sea views and walk 50 metres down to Te Oneroa beach. Make yourself a campfire and BBQ under starlit nights.
Te Kaha is renowned for its fishing and crayfishing and the nearest boat ramps are Waihau Bay and Te Kaha.

Reviews
“We have been staying in baches for the last 20 years and this would be one of the best we have rented. Leanne and Warwick were very welcoming and by the end of the stay we almost felt like family. The bach is very well appointed and has plenty of room and a very nice sleepout for extended family members. It is very comfortable with two big couches and two lazy boys in the lounge and wonderful views out over the sea. There is plenty of room for soccer and cricket on the large lawn outside the bach, which was great for our boys and their cousins. The bach is across the road from a surf beach and five minutes walk to a safe swimming beach. The cafe and store are just up the road with a restaurant another 5 minutes drive away. We would have no hesitation in recommending this bach to other holiday makers, it is a great spot to get away from it all. “
